The Minnesota Twins have signed their supplemental first-round draft pick Luke Bard, reports Jim Callis of Baseball America. The Twins selected Bard with their third and final draft pick, and he was the only that remained unsigned according to our MLB Draft Signings Tracker.
The Chicago Cubs have signed 15 of their draft picks, including supplemental first-round draft pick Paul Blackburn reports Carrie Muskat of MLB.com. Terms of the deal have not been disclosed, but Major League Baseball's recommend slot signing bonus for Blackburn was $911,700.
The Houston Astros and supplemental first-round draft pick Lance McCullers have agreed to a deal, reports Jim Callis of Baseball America. The deal is worth $2.5 million, which is roughly $1.24 million more than Major League Baseball's recommended slot signing bonus.
The Boston Red Sox have signed supplemental first-round draft pick Pat Light, writes WEEI.com's Alex Speier. The Monmouth University product received a bonus of $1 million, which is below Major League Baseball's recommended slot signing bonus of $1.394 million for the 37th pick.
The St. Louis Cardinals have signed supplemental first-round pick Stephen Piscotty, according to Jim Callis of Baseball America. Piscotty signed for Major League Baseball's recommended slot signing bonus for the 36th overall draft pick, which is valued at $1.43 million.
The Oakland Athletics have signed supplemental first-round draft pick Daniel Robertson, according to Jim Callis Baseball America. Robertson received Major League Baseball's recommended slot signing bonus for the 34th overall selection, which is valued at $1.5 million.
The San Diego Padres have signed supplemental first-round draft pick Zach Eflin, reports Dan Hayes of the North County Times. According to Hayes, Eflin will sign for $1.2 million; that is below MLB's recommended slot signing bonus for the 33rd overall draft pick, which is valued at $1.5 million. The deal is pending a physical.
The San Diego Padres have signed seventh-overall draft pick Max Fried, the club announced via Twitter. Dan Hayes of the North County Times reports Fried signed for MLB's recommend slot signing bonus for the 7th overall draft pick, which is valued at $3 million.

The Texas Rangers have signed their top five selections in this year's MLB draft, including first-round draft picks Lewis Brinson, Joey Gallo and Collin Wiles, Executive Vice President of Communications John Blake announced.
The New York Mets have agreed to a deal with supplemental first-round draft pick Kevin Plawecki, reports Jim Callis of Baseball America. Plawecki signed for a $1.4 million signing bonus, which is just below MLB's recommend slot signing bonus for the 35th overall draft pick at $1,467,400.
The Milwaukee Brewers have signed another one of their first-round draft picks, this time it's supplemental first-round selection Mitch Haniger, reports Jim Callis of Baseball America. The Cal Poly university outfielder Mitch Haniger agreed to a $1.2 million signing bonus, which is below MLB's recommended slot signing bonus for the pick at $1,359,100.
The Philadelphia Phillies have signed supplemental first-round draft pick Mitchell Gueller, according to Jim Callis of Baseball America. Gueller, a Washington High School right-handed pitcher, signed for the full $940,200 slot signing bonus recommended by the MLB office for the 54th overall draft pick.
The Chicago Cubs have signed first-round supplemental draft pick Pierce Johnson, reports, well no other than Pierce Johnson himself (via Twitter) of course. According to Kendall Rogers of Perfect Game USA, the Cubs signed Pierce Johnson close to or right at MLB's recommended slot signing bonus of $1.196 million.
The Colorado Rockies and first-round draft pick David Dahl have agreed to terms on a signing bonus, reports Kendall Rogers of Perfect Game USA. The bonus is worth $2.6 million, which is just under MLB's recommended slot signing bonus of $2.7 million. According to Rogers, Dahl will sign Tuesday and forgo his commitment to Auburn University.
The Philadelphia Phillies and first-round draft pick Shane Watson have agreed to a signing bonus of $1,291,300 according to Jim Callis of Baseball America. The signing bonus the two parties agreed to is exactly the MLB recommended slot signing bonus for the 40th overall pick, the slot Watson was drafted at.
The Cincinnati Reds are close to signing first-round draft pick Nick Travieso, Reds general manager Walt Jocketty told Mark Sheldon of MLB.com. Travieso, the 14th overall draft pick, is from Archbishop McCarthy High School near Fort Lauderdale, Florida.
The Toronto Blue Jays have signed first-round draft pick D.J. Davis, Mitch Nay and 20 other draft picks reports Jim Callis of Baseball America. Davis signed for $1.75 million, 250K below MLB's recommended slot signing bonus for that pick. Callis later tweeted Nay's signing bonus, which was over MLB's recommended bonus, so it looks the money saved on Davis went to Nay.
